BIDDEFORD, Maine -- Sophomore
Lizzie Wareham (Osterville, Mass.) swam the first leg of the 200-yard freestyle relay in 25.12 to qualify for the Eastern College Athletic Conference (ECAC) Championships in late February. The University of New England cruised to victory in the event, and finished off a 157-104 win over Saint Joseph's College (Maine) Wednesday evening at the Campus Center.
Wareham also won a pair of individual events for the Nor'easters (8-4), taking the 100-yard butterfly (1:02.45) and 100-yard freestyle (58.22).
First-year
Meaghan Arsenault (Methuen, Mass.) claimed two races of her own for UNE, winning the 200-yard backstroke and 50-yard freestyle (27.86). In the 200 back, she shattered the Campus Center pool record with a time of 2:23.91, besting the previous mark of 2:25.11 set by Courtney Burdick '09 back during the 2006-07 season.
Saint Joseph's sophomore Hannah Gajewski (Biddeford, Maine) led the Monks (5-2), swimming to victory in both the 100- and 200-yard individual medley events. Gajewski also finished second to UNE's
Sara Shea (Peabody, Mass.) in the 200-yard breaststroke.
First-year
Rachel Hanley (Wiscasset, Maine) took second by 0.25 seconds to Gajewski in the 100 IM, but was part of a much closer race early on in the meet. Monks sophomore Rose Maccarrone (Hingham, Maine) edged Hanley in the 50-yard breaststroke by 0.01, clocking a time of 36.61.
UNE senior
Alison Leopard (Bloomington, Ill.) was victorious in both the 200- and 500-yard freestyle events, while sophomore
Nori McLeod (Wiscasset, Maine) won the 50-yard backstroke (31.82).
Senior Ashton Piers (Falmouth, Maine) picked up the remaining individual event of the night, touching the wall in the 50-yard butterfly in 32.53 -- 0.06 seconds ahead of the Nor'easters'
Allie Travnik (New Lenox, Ill.).
Both teams are off until the New England Intercollegiate Swimming & Diving Association (NEISDA) Championships, which will be held February 19-22 at the Upper Valley Aquatics Center in White River Junction, Vt.
